Nowadays, with the rapid development of science and technology, modern ship presents the trend of large-scale and automation. The continuity, reliability and quality of electricity powered by marine electric power system have a direct influence on technical specifications, economic indicators and vitality of ships. Therefore, the process of monitoring, management and control of ship power station becomes increasingly important. In the present research, the protection and paralleling unit of ship power station is designed according to the related information provided by the domestic and overseas power station as well as the PPU product of DIFF Company. The direction of the research is to explore the adoption and innovation of marine embedded technology with computer science at the core.The main functions and operating principles of the protection and paralleling unit are presented. The present research also elaborates the signal acquisition circuit including voltage signal acquisition circuit, current signal acquisition circuit and frequency acquisition circuit. Furthermore, calculation principle of triphase factor and the overall design plan of the protection and paralleling unit are introduced. Moreover, circuit design of the whole system is illustrated including Altium Designer Summer09, the development environment of hardware design and how to choose the component and connect the circuit. And the research demonstrates LPC2132, the processor core on ARM and ADS1.2, the software development environment utilized in the present research. It also shows how the unit controls the display screen and keys, the protection of parametric, automatic parallel operation and other functions.In the final section, the methodology and process of the communication debugging of the protection and paralleling unit as well as the upper computer is illustrated. The circuit board has been debugged. Based on the debugging results and design principles, the unit could achieve the function of protection and paralleling of the power station.
